About the Role

The Company is seeking an Executive Director of Development for its College of Liberal Arts and Sciences. The successful candidate will be responsible for leading and managing the development and fundraising activities within the college. This includes creating and implementing strategic plans to secure philanthropic support, building and maintaining relationships with alumni, donors, and other stakeholders, and overseeing a team of development professionals. The role demands a visionary leader who can effectively communicate the college's mission and priorities, and who is adept at identifying and cultivating major gift prospects.Applicants for the Executive Director of Development position at the company's College of Liberal Arts and Sciences should have a proven track record in fundraising, with a focus on major gifts. A deep understanding of the academic and research environment, particularly in the liberal arts and sciences, is essential. The ideal candidate will have experience in donor stewardship, campaign management, and working with faculty and leadership to align fundraising efforts with institutional goals. A Bachelor's degree is required, and a Master's degree is preferred. The role also requires excellent communication, interpersonal, and leadership skills, as well as the ability to work collaboratively in a diverse and dynamic academic setting.
